No the club can not come to their own conclussions on his guilt, If the club were to sack him believing in all fairness he is guilty and a court eventualy finds otherwise it opens the door for legal action against WT.

Where do you pull this from? The club has got their own code of conduct, and they can conduct their own investigation and sack him if they determine a breach to that code.

Its been done by other clubs. The Bronco's punted John Te Reo and Ian Lacey for code of conduct breaches before the charges came to court. Codes of conduct are enforceable completely independent of criminal law in almost every workplace.

Of course most clubs just prefer to sit back and watch the legal process unravel because most of the time it means they have to do pretty much nothing, because these domestic abuse causes very rarely stand up in court. (Robert Lui Episode 1, Anthony Watt's, Greg Inglis, Greg Bird so on and so forth). And so as a result of Wests Tigers taking that exact approach last time, they have to wear the bad publicity when it happens again.
